Värn 868 is a Swedish civil defense bunker located near Växjö in southern Sweden. Built during the Cold War era as part of Sweden's comprehensive civil defense strategy, this bunker represents the country's extensive preparations for potential nuclear conflict during the heightened tensions of the 20th century. The facility was designed to provide protection for civilians in the event of a nuclear attack, reflecting Sweden's policy of armed neutrality and its commitment to safeguarding its population through robust civil defense infrastructure.

The bunker is part of Sweden's network of approximately 65,000 civil defense shelters, which were constructed to protect a significant portion of the population. These structures were strategically distributed throughout the country, with many located in urban areas and near population centers. Värn 868 specifically would have been designed to withstand blast effects and radiation from nuclear weapons, featuring reinforced concrete construction and air filtration systems typical of Cold War-era civil defense facilities.

Today, Värn 868 stands as a historical monument to Sweden's Cold War preparedness, offering insights into the era's civil defense philosophy and the architectural solutions developed to address nuclear threats. The bunker's preservation allows for educational opportunities regarding Cold War history and the evolution of civil defense strategies in neutral nations during periods of global tension.
